How to Choose a Photo That Tells Your Story
The best photo for a gift is rarely the one where everyone is perfectly posed and smiling for the camera. The real magic lies in the pictures that capture a genuine moment—a feeling, an inside joke, a quiet glance. Think about the photos on your phone that make you stop and smile without even thinking about it. Those are your best candidates.
A candid shot almost always tells a richer story than a formal portrait. Scroll through your camera roll and look for the images that really capture the essence of your partner. Maybe it’s that slightly blurry picture of them laughing so hard they’re crying, or a sweet, simple moment you caught on a random Tuesday. These authentic snapshots are pure gold for creating an anniversary gift that feels truly personal.

Designing Your Unique Photo Gift
Once you've settled on a canvas, most online personalization tools make the design process a breeze. This is your chance to add those little details that elevate the gift.
For our beach sunset example, you could add the location and date in a subtle, elegant font at the bottom—something simple like "Maui, 2023."
The font choice itself says a lot. A classic serif font (think Times New Roman) can give it a timeless, romantic feel. On the other hand, a clean sans-serif font (like Helvetica) looks more modern and crisp. My advice? Try out a few. See what complements the vibe of the photo instead of competing with it. The goal is always to enhance the memory, not distract from it.

We're almost there! The final step is choosing the materials and finish. For a canvas, you can often pick different frame depths or edge styles. A gallery-wrapped edge gives it a clean, modern look that seems to float on the wall. A classic floating frame can add a touch of gallery-like sophistication. These little decisions help make sure the final piece fits perfectly with your home's decor.

Getting the Timing Right
Okay, let's talk timelines. This is where a lot of people get tripped up. Always, always check the estimated production and shipping times before you order. It usually takes a few business days to create your custom piece, and then you have to factor in shipping. Forgetting this simple step is the number one reason gifts arrive late.

Creative Ideas Beyond Photo Gifts

As much as we love a good photo gift, sometimes the most powerful memories aren't captured in a picture. Thinking beyond the visual can lead you to some incredibly unique and intimate anniversary gifts that tap into your other shared senses.
What about the soundtrack of your relationship? You know, "your song." But what if you could actually see it? That's where soundwave art comes in. It takes an audio clip—like your first dance song or even a sweet voicemail—and turns it into a piece of visual art. It’s a modern, cool way to display a feeling a photo just can't capture.
Turning Shared Moments Into Art
Another idea I've always loved is capturing a meaningful place. A custom illustration of the church where you got married or that little café where you had your first date tells a specific chapter of your story. It’s a beautiful tribute to the foundation you’ve built together, brick by brick.
If you want to dig a little deeper, think about other experiences you've shared:
- A Personalized Recipe Book: Gather all the recipes for meals you’ve loved making together. Scribble in little notes, inside jokes, or even a photo from a particularly memorable dinner party. It becomes a culinary scrapbook of your life.
 - A Custom Star Map: This one is pure romance. Get a print of how the stars looked on a big night—the day you met, your wedding day, you name it. It's a gorgeous reminder of a moment that was literally written in the stars.
 - A "Where We Met" Map: Simple, but so powerful. Frame the exact coordinates of where it all began. It's a minimalist and meaningful piece of décor that honors your origin story.

How Far in Advance Should I Order?
This is probably the biggest question people have, and the answer really depends on what you're ordering. For most of our custom photo-to-print items, giving yourself a 2-3 week cushion is a pretty safe bet. That usually covers the 3-7 business days it takes to produce the item, plus time for standard shipping.
However, if you're commissioning something really intricate, like a custom illustration from scratch or a hand-painted piece of art, you'll want to plan much further ahead. For those kinds of highly personal projects, I'd recommend ordering at least 4-6 weeks before your anniversary.
My best piece of advice? Always, always, always check the seller's estimated production and shipping timeline before you click "buy." It takes two seconds and can save you a world of hurt.
